2026年Java数据结构与算法专项训练试题.docxVIP

  • 2
  • 0
  • 约1.3万字
  • 约 20页
  • 2026-06-01 发布于湖北
  • 举报

2026年Java数据结构与算法专项训练试题.docx

2026年Java数据结构与算法专项训练试题

考试时间:______分钟总分:______分姓名:______

一、选择题

1.下列哪种数据结构是先进后出(LIFO)的?

A.队列

B.栈

C.链表

D.哈希表

2.在数组`arr`中,删除索引为`i`的元素(假设`i`合法且`arr`非空),最坏情况下需要移动多少个元素?

A.0

B.`i`

C.`i+1`

D.`arr.length-i-1`

3.下列关于链表的描述中,正确的是?

A.链表需要连续的内存空间

B.链表的随机访问效率很高

C.链表插入和删除操作通常比数组快

D.链表的空间复杂度通常比数组高

4.在`HashMap`中,当哈希冲突发生时,通常采用哪种方法来解决?

A.抛出异常

B.线性探测

C.链地址法

D.重新哈希

5.下列哪个集合类是线程不安全的?

A.`Vector`

B.`ArrayList`

C.`LinkedList`

D.`HashMap`

6.判断一个二叉树是否是二叉搜索树(BST),最有效的方法是进行?

A.前序遍历

文档评论(0)

1亿VIP精品文档

相关文档